Kansas Requirements (What You Must Know)
Minimum Liability
Current KS minimums are $25,000/$50,000 bodily injury and $25,000 property damage. We’ll quote higher limits that better fit Hollenberg’s rural exposure.
MedPay Considerations
Kansas doesn’t mandate PIP for motorcycles. Add Medical Payments (MedPay) to help with medical expenses regardless of fault.
Helmet & Eye Protection
KS requires helmets for riders under 18; all riders should wear approved helmets. Eye protection is recommended for safety on open roads.
Inspection & Lane Splitting
No routine state inspection required. Lane splitting isn’t permitted in KS—follow general traffic laws.
This is a summary. Your policy controls. We’ll review carrier forms and endorsements with you before binding.

Getting Your Kansas Motorcycle Endorsement
Course Path (Recommended)
- Enroll in an approved Basic RiderCourse (BRC)
- Pass the course; bring completion to KDOR
- Add the M endorsement
Permit + Testing Path
- Get motorcycle permit (knowledge + vision)
- Practice under restrictions
- Take road test; add endorsement
Bike Size & Restrictions
Testing on small bikes may restrict; courses often waive this—check with us.
